Brushing your teeth properly is important for your overall mouth health. When brushing your teeth, use a vertical motion on the outside of your teeth and a horizontal motion on the inner parts of your teeth. Concentrate your efforts by brushing each tooth for approximately fifteen seconds to help ensure proper cleaning.

It’s important to brush your teeth at least twice a day. The first time should be after breakfast to get rid of all the gunk on your teeth from your meal and from sleeping overnight. The second time is before bed, ensuring that you clean off dinner detritus and daily build-up.





When brushing your teeth, try not to neglect your tongue. Many people overlook the tongue; however, it is extremely important that it stays clean. There are all kinds of bacteria on the tongue. If this bacteria remains on your tongue, it will be transferred to your teeth. Additionally, the bacteria can contribute to bad breath.

To avoid serious and possible permanent damage to your teeth, never use them for any activity other than chewing the food that you eat. You run the risk of chipping or cracking your teeth whenever you use your teeth to open a package, pull something that is stuck or crack open nutshells.

To ensure your toothbrush is clean and free from harmful bacteria, you should get a new one every couple of months. Buy a toothbrush which is either medium or soft. Hard bristles can often be the cause of gum bleeding and pain, as well as make you lose enamel. For optimal quality, go with a name brand.

Do not forget to floss before brushing to remove food particles that may be trapped between the teeth. If you have a hard time with regular dental floss, try a package of the handy dental picks that have floss built in. These little devices make it easier to reach awkward spaces in the back of your mouth.

Do what you can to keep your mouth fresh. To check your breath’s freshness, try licking your palm and smelling it while it’s wet. If there’s a smell, try grabbing a breath mint that’s sugar-free. If you need a mouthwash to combat this issue, look for an alcohol-free mouthwash. Many of the over-the-counter varieties contain too much alcohol. This dries out your mouth and leaves it susceptible to harmful bacteria.

Another key to effective dental care revolves around the proper storage of the toothbrush itself. This may seem like a small thing, but making sure the brush is thoroughly rinsed after use and stored upright so it can air dry is essential in order to stave off the growth of potentially harmful bacteria.

If you notice any swelling in your mouth you should seek the help of your dentist right away. There are many problems that you could have, but if you happen to have an abscess, you really need your dentist to help you to take care of the problem so that it doesn’t turn into something serious.
